I have a 2005 h2 and i went to put it in park and the shifter slid forward real easy with out pushing the button in. now the shifter handle is stuck in park but on the dash it says its in drive which it is stuck in drive. the shifter and the digital dash do not match. with the shifter stuck in park i am able to turn the truck off and pull the key out of the ignition. but now the truck wont start becouse the digital dash reads it is still in drive which it is the truck will not start. is there a easy solution?

  • Anonymous May 04, 2010

    i did call the dealership and they told me there are no recalls on the shifters. but i explained what was the problem and he told me on the end of the shifter cable under the vehicle where the linkage hooks up there is a plastic clip that connects the cable to the linkage. the plastice clip broke and fell apart making the cable detach. the only way to fix it is to replace the shifter cable that has the clip on it part cost about $80.00 it takes a technition about 2 hours to install.that is what my problem is and now i can fix it. i thought you would be able to use this info for future questions.

2006 Hummer H2 stuck in park. It will start but I can not move the shifter.

I wish I own my Hummer when you asked this question, on my 04 as well 03 H2 ran in the same issue, its a simple but will drive you nuts to fix, maybe this will help anyone with the same issue now. First you have to remove your shifter handle, use a 2nd to the smallest Allen wrench to remove the small nut on the shifter, make sure don't completely take it out, because its small and you can loose it easy while unscrew that nut, once your handle is loose, removed the handle, than in your center console, there is 3 to 4 bolts depends how many is there has to come out, than once remove the center console box you will see 4 more bolts you have to remove, one of the bolts is on the middle, it connect the base to the body closer to your shifter, than you also need to remove the frame that is holding your AC unit as well your radio, I did not take that off but loose enough to pull outva little so you can pull out the center console that is clip under that frame that's holding on your radio and AC unit, once the frame is loose enough you can pull it out slowly so you wont break the plastic frame cover, its nightmare, once you removed the center console frame, your main shifter unit will be that whole shifting box connected to your shifting pole. On the right side by the main unit, you will see 2 thing, one issue is the connecter with 5 wires that goes in the shifting module is been either cut or loose, because Hummer use a such thin wire and as the time goes by each time you shift it either pull the wires up or down because it does move that connector with it, and those wires some will be pulled out with shifting movent out, and somewiir the movent will take its toll and some will be cut in half due to Hummer use plastic to make everything. You could either run a thicker wires and make sure its long enough so its not too tight, that is how those thin wire break, or you can go to Autozone and get a new connector I think is call the Pigtail standard 6 prom, or called shifting solenoid pigtail connector, its already set up, and 5 time thicker wires, just cut the old connector one wire at a time, so cut one than attach to the new connector so you dont get the wire mess up. Than plug it back in and fixed. Also trick to manually unlock your shifter so you can use your H2 before you can fix it, same way to get into the wiring connector by your solenoid, you will see kind of like a button little to the right just under the connector, push that in and shift than release the button, only time you need to shift from park you have to push that button to drive your H2. When putting back your handle, make sure you shift to Drive or lower gear, than put on the handle until it stop, tight the nut and your done, because the handle has a small spring, if you push in the handle than you can push that button on the handle as well if you put too loose, so best way is put it in D or 2 gear, and drop that handle on the pole and enough that you starting to but pressure but stop there and tight it up you should be good, if this long message will help anyone with the same issue.

Gear shift is locked in park on2008chevrolet impala LTZ Istopped the car put it in park with car running went to take it out of park and it will not come out of park tried moving steering wheel back and...

Check that the brake sensor is alright. Try putting a new one in at the pedal if you don't have a test light or continuity meter to test it. If the brake being applied is not being sensed by the computer, then it will not allow the shifter to unlock. Possible solenoid problem with shifter, as well, if the brake sensor checks out ok.

Went to park in my 2006 envoy. Shifter got stuck in neutral and the shifter button will not depress.

Same thing happened to me today(but while in drive!). had to crawl UNDER vehicle, driver side, behind the transmission where it narrows down, and the shifting rod (connected to your shifter in vehicle) came disconnected from what i assume was a gear knob on transmission. its basically a screw and nut holding the two together. ill temporarily replace it tomorrow until i can order correct screw and nut. hope this is same situation and helps. easy fix.

ps if you push the gear -knob all the way forwards under vehicle, that is in the Park gear.

Shift gear is stuck on park and can't get it out of gear.

Hi there,

There are multiple things that must all happen in order for the shifter to move from park.

1. Make sure the key ignition switch is in the "Run" position (the position just before the "start" position).

2. Brake pedal is depressed (usually pushed in a couple of inches or more at least to release the button on the shifter).

3. Push in the button on the shifter and pull back (you may need to push the shifter slightly forward or back a little for the button to move freely).

If the button on the shifter still doesn't push in freely, there is a problem with the mechanical lock-out linkage or electronic switch that releases the button lock. Check under the dash area along the brake pedal arm for anything that doesn't look correct.

4. If the car is on an incline/slope/hill, it will put a lot of pressure on the parking pin in the transmission. Usually a strong tug or pull on the shifter will pull it out while you're pushing on the brake pedal to prevent rolling when it releases. Make sure to set the parking/emergency brake first to prevent this next time .

Shifter is stuck in park

The shift cable is off the lever on the trans...the dash indicator states drive but the shifter is in park. Look under the drivers side of the trans, next to the catalytic converter(make sure the truck is cooled off) the trans cable will not be attached to the tranny lever-re-attach and you will be able to get it home or to a shop for a repair. This happened to me already, simple fix.
